TensorFlow 的基本概念和使用场景

TensorFlow 是 Google 开源的机器学习框架,它支持使用数据流图(Data Flow Graph)的方式进行计算,以实现大规模分布式机器学习应用。TensorFlow 在深度学习、自然语言处理、计算机视觉等领域有广泛应用。

TensorFlow 中的重要概念包括:

  • 张量(Tensor):TensorFlow 中的基本数据类型,类似于多维数组。
  • 计算图(Graph):由一系列节点(Node)和边(Edge)组成的图结构,节点表示操作,边表示张量之间的依赖关系。
  • 会话(Session):用于执行计算图中的操作的环境。

TensorFlow 的使用场景包括图像分类、语音识别、自然语言处理、机器翻译、推荐系统等。它可以用于训练多种模型,如全连接神经网络、卷积神经网络、循环神经网络等,也可以用于深度强化学习等领域的研究。同时,TensorFlow 支持在 CPU、GPU、TPU 等硬件平台上进行高效计算,适合在大规模分布式系统中进行分布式训练和推理。

相关推荐
测试19981 小时前
Web自动化测试:测试用例流程设计
自动化测试·软件测试·python·selenium·测试工具·职场和发展·测试用例
山烛5 小时前
矿物分类系统开发笔记(一):数据预处理
人工智能·python·机器学习·矿物分类
拾零吖5 小时前
吴恩达 Machine Learning(Class 3)
人工智能·机器学习
admiraldeworm5 小时前
Spring Boot + Spring AI 最小可运行 Demo
java·人工智能·ai
算法_小学生6 小时前
长短期记忆网络(LSTM)
人工智能·rnn·lstm
Virgil1396 小时前
【TrOCR】模型预训练权重各个文件解读
人工智能·pytorch·计算机视觉·自然语言处理·ocr·transformer
MaxCode-16 小时前
【机器学习 / 深度学习】基础教程
人工智能·深度学习·机器学习
先做个垃圾出来………6 小时前
神经网络(Neural Network, NN)
人工智能·深度学习·神经网络
我希望的一路生花7 小时前
Nik Collection 6.2全新版Nik降噪锐化调色PS/LR插件
人工智能·计算机视觉·设计模式·stable diffusion·aigc
.银河系.7 小时前
819 机器学习-决策树2
人工智能·决策树·机器学习